What is Vymo?
Founded in 2013 by industry veterans Yamini and Venkat, Vymo has rapidly emerged as a leading global enterprise SaaS provider. The company specializes in sales transformation, leveraging intelligent mobile applications to enhance sales productivity and effectiveness for large enterprises. With a presence across key markets in the US, Japan, Singapore, India, Indonesia, Vietnam, and Thailand, Vymo is recognized as one of the fastest-growing SaaS firms worldwide. Its core mission revolves around empowering sales teams with data-driven insights and streamlined workflows, facilitating significant improvements in customer engagement and revenue generation.
How much funding has Vymo raised?
Vymo has raised a total of $45M across 3 funding rounds:

Series A (2016): $5M with participation from Steamboat Ventures
Series B (2019): $18M led by Emergence Capital Partners
Series C (2022): $22M supported by Sequoia Capital, Bertelsmann India Investments, and Emergence Capital Partners
Key Investors in Vymo
Sequoia Capital
Sequoia Capital is a prominent venture capital firm with a significant presence in India, managing substantial funds and investing across various stages of company growth. They are known for their long-term approach and active partnership with entrepreneurs to build global market leaders.
Bertelsmann India Investments
Bertelsmann India Investments (BII) is a venture capital fund focused on early growth-stage tech startups, particularly in sectors like healthtech, fintech, and edtech. As the strategic investment arm of Bertelsmann in India, BII provides capital and supports companies in scaling their businesses.
Emergence Capital Partners
Emergence Capital is a leading venture capital firm specializing in early-stage enterprise companies. Their mission is to be a valuable partner to companies that are fundamentally changing how the world works through innovative technology solutions.
